‘Peaky Blinders’ Dance Production Heads to China


British theater producer ROYO (Room On Your Own) is strengthening its presence in Asia through subsidiary RTS Entertainment, which will present Rambert’s “Peaky Blinders: The Redemption of Thomas Shelby” to Chinese audiences next year.

The stage adaptation of the popular series follows the Shelby family from World War I battlefields through Birmingham’s post-war landscape. Steven Knight, who created the television show, wrote the script, while Rambert artistic director Benoit Swan Pouffer handled choreography and direction. Roman GianArthur composed original music for the live band, which also performs songs by Nick Cave and the Bad Seeds, Radiohead, Anna Calvi, The Last Shadow Puppets, Frank Carter & The Rattlesnakes, and Black Rebel Motorcycle Club.

The dance-theater production will tour mainland China during spring 2026, timed to coincide with the renowned dance company Rambert’s 100th anniversary and representing their return to the Chinese market. RTS has now staged five shows in China over the last year and a half, most recently presenting the Olivier-winning “Life of Pi” and Agatha Christie’s “Murder on the Orient Express.”

“International touring has always been part of Rambert’s DNA: it connects us beyond language, strengthens creative partnerships, and sustains our future at a time when global exchange is not only inspiring, but essential for artistic and financial resilience,” said Helen Shute, CEO of Rambert. “We are truly honored to return in our centenary year, and with the support of Boris and the RTS team, to meet our audiences in China again.”

Boris Cao, CEO of RTS Entertainment, added: “We are very proud to bring Rambert back to China in celebration of their 100th year. Chinese audiences will connect deeply with ‘Peaky Blinders’ universal story of hope and rebirth, just like audiences in the U.K..”

ROYO Group CEO Tom De Keyser revealed continued investment in RTS’s Shanghai operations while attending the current “Murder on the Orient Express” engagement in the city.

“Having RTS within the ROYO Group allows us to provide unparalleled support to British producers and performing arts institutions seeking to export their work to global audiences,” De Keyser said. “Audiences and theaters in China are some of the best in the world, and hold British productions in great esteem, so it continues to be a growing market that we are excited to be working in.”

The Shanghai and London-based RTS Entertainment operates as a production and presentation company within ROYO Group, which encompasses theater production, marketing services and licensing operations across multiple territories.
